Reflector and reflector lamp

A reflector in a light fixture uses reflective surfaces toShielding the light source and the light path. If these surfaces are highly reflective, they act as reflectors that direct the light; depending on the reflector’s design, this results in different light intensity distributions and beam angles. If, on the other hand, the surfaces are painted white, the light is scattered and distributed diffusely. In general, the efficiency and theLight Distribution largely depends on the installation depth of theLight source as well as the size of the reflector.

If such a reflector no longer needs to be added separately to a light fixture but is already permanently installed, the light is known as a “reflector lamp.” It has a glass bulb with an internal mirror coating, which controls both the beam angle and theLight Guidance ...are used. Built-in reflectors can be found, for example, inGeneral-purpose incandescent light bulbsLED Light sources, PAR lamps, and high-voltage and low-voltage halogen lamps.

Reflectors and reflector lamps are often used in retail stores orArchitectural Lighting, but also anywhere else where you want to create accent lighting. Reflector lamps are just as well-suited for highlighting and showcasing individual areas or objects.
